Technical Tester

Contributing to manual testing:

  • Analyze and refine functional and non-functional requirements, ensuring clarity and feasibility.
  • Identify and suggest enhancements, both functionally and technically.
  • Develop, implement, execute and lead comprehensive test plans for various testing phases, Sanity, Smoke, Integration, Regression, E2E, in different environments: Test, Acceptance.
  • Oversee the entire defect life cycle and manage test case data sets and inputs.

Specializing in SQL database & API testing:

  • Perform and lead database testing using SQL Server or Oracle DB Developer, including SQL queries building and SQL procedures.
  • Manage data workflows using JSON/XML files from source systems.
  • Lead API testing initiatives using tools like Postman, Swagger, Ready API, SOAP UI across different phases and environments.
  • Manage API defect life cycle and collaborate closely with other squads.

Enhancing QA processes, supervision, and reporting:

  • Contribute to the improvement of internal QA processes and methodologies.
  • Regularly report on QA progress to Management, Product and Development teams, and offer support across departments.
  • Produce detailed QA/Test Reports for various teams, ensuring clear communication of findings and progress.

Essential Knowledge and Skills:

  • Proficiency with tools like Ready API, Swagger, Postman, SQL Server/Oracle DB, XML/JSON, Jira/Xray, GIT/Bitbucket, Jenkins, and Cosmos DB.
  • Solid understanding of the Software Development Lifecycle (SDLC).
  • Skilled in testing processes, from requirement analysis to test completion report.

Test Automation Skills:

  • Proficiency with tools and Frontend automation Libraries like Playwright.
  • SQL Server/Oracle DB PLSQL for Data validity control
  • API Test automation using Postman, SOAP UI or Ready API
  • Create and execute Jobs for Test automation sets/ Campaigns using Jenkins or Microsoft Azure Suite.

Leadership and Interpersonal Skills:

  • Possess problem-solving skills, a positive attitude, and proactive initiative-taking.
  • Collaborate effectively with both manual and automation testers, bridging gaps between different testing approaches.
